San Juan Nepomuceno

NameCarving, Figure
Artist Artist unrecorded
Place madeNEW MEXICO, United States, Southwest, North America
DimensionsOverall: 13 9/16 in. (34.5 cm)
Credit LineMuseum of International Folk Art, bequest of Cady Wells, A9.1954.22 B
Object numberA9.1954.22 B
DescriptionTorso carved from simple block, quite tall in proportion to head, but santero added another block of robe. The backward slant of the figure was thus exaggerated until it will now not stand up without a prop behind it. Arms attached by nails so that they swing when touched. Conventional surplice and biretta of S.J.N. Retrousse nose, staring black eyes.
